Ladies & Gentlemen,
I am pleased to announce the Barbarians 2010 World Cup Competition is now open to all!
We've set up an auction system, bidding for each team competing in the World Cup finals. The person who ultimately bids the highest for each team will hold the ticket for that team going into the World Cup Finals, starting on Friday 11th June, 2010.
Here's the format:
Bidding: Any person can bid for any team. A bid is made when I recieve an email OR a text message including the Team name, the bid amount and the sender's details.
There are two bid amounts - 10rmb & 50rmb. This means you can bid 10rmb or 50rmb (if you're keen!). All bids will be chronologically recorded. When I receive a bid, I will record the change in an overall spreadhseet for each team.
Once a bid is made it is binding and all payments must be followed through!
Announcments: I will update the club via email showing the latest bid position and the name of the current 'owner' of the each bid team. I will do this at least 3x a week from now...and every day in the last week running up to the close of bidding.
The first game is on Friday 11th June. Bidding will close at 11pm on Thursday 10th June. An official listing of winning bids, bid prices and names will be published via email and on the Club website. (To make it fair, as I am the controller...I will not be able to make a bid after 10.58pm on Thursday 10th June).
Prizes: The person who holds the bid for the eventual World Cup winning team is deemed the winner, and will be awarded 1st place prize. The loser of the final, will be deemed the 2nd place prizer winner. The winner of the 3rd & 4th placed match, will be the 3rd place prize winner.
1st Prize: 40% of the total bid money 2nd Prize 30% of the total bid money 3rd prize 20% of the total bid money
* This is a club fundraiser so 10% of the bid money will go to the club. ** NOTE: Danger Doyle's have been invited to offer additional prizes too, so hopefully each prize place will get an additional award from them.
